A Multi-camera based Next Best View Approach for Semantic Scene Understanding

Persson, Anton January 2023 (has links)
Robots are becoming more common; robotics has gone from bleeding-edge technology to an everyday topic that families discuss around thedinner table.The number of robots in the industry is growing, which means thatthe demand and need for robots to understand the environment it isworking in is also growing.The standard method for a robot to gather information about a sceneinvolves moving to different pre-determined poses from which it canview and analyze the scene. However, this approach does not con-sider the topology of the scene that the robot should explore.This thesis aims to create a two-dimensional approach to determinethe next best view ( 2D-NBV) to view and explore the scene, intro-duced in the method section.The 2D-NBV method converts a point cloud of the scene to an ele-vation map. A segmenting network is used to get the positions ofpre-trained objects. The positions are then used to generate a2DGaussian kernel heatmap of the scene. Using the 2D elevation andGaussian map, the NBV pose is then calculated. The NBV pose isthen converted back to a 6D pose that the robot moves to capture anew point cloud and register it to the scene.The 2D-NBV method is compared to a baseline and a state-of-the-artmethod. The baseline method captures four different point cloudsfrom pre-determined positions and registers them together. The state-of-the-art methods find a point of interest and declare a set of viewcandidates on a sphere around the point. Ray casting is used to findthe pose with the highest information gain. This pose is set as theNBV for the robot to move to. The goal of this thesis is that themethod should perform better than the baseline method, describedfurther in the method section.The evaluation metric used in this thesis is how wellthe differentmethods could estimate the bounding boxes of pre-trained items us-ing an off-the-shelf semantic scene segmentation method. Six sceneswith varying difficulty were constructed to test the methods.The results showed that the 2D-NBV method successfully comple-mented the scene with information about its empty cells. The 2D-NBV outperforms the state-of-the-art on occluded scenes. The 2D-NBV performed overall just as well as the baseline. The reason thatthe 2D-NBV did not outperform the baseline is seen as a consequenceof the information loss going from 3D to 2D.

Stoneflies of Unusual Size: Population Genetics and Systematics Within Pteronarcyidae (Plecoptera)

Sproul, John S. 12 July 2012 (has links) (PDF)
Chapter 1. The family Pteronarcyidae (Plecoptera) is a highly studied group of stoneflies and very important to a wide variety of aquatic studies. Several phylogenies have been proposed for this group recent decades, however there is little congruence between the various topologies. The present study revises the phylogeny of the group by combining molecular data from mitochondrial cytochrome oxidase subunit II, ribosomal subunit 12S, ribosomal subunit 16S, and nuclear loci ribosomal subinit 18S and Histone H3, with published morphological data in a parsimony-based total evidence analysis. The analysis produced a well-supported phylogeny with novel relationships within the genus Pteronarcys. Maximum Likelihood and Bayesian analyses produced topologies congruent with parsimony analysis. Character mapping revealed several homoplasious morphological characters that were previously thought to be homologous. Chapter 2. Phylogeographic studies in aquatic insects provide valuable insights into mechanisms that shape the genetic structure of aquatic communities. Yet studies that include broad geographic areas are uncommon for this group. We conducted a broad scale phylogeographic analysis of P. badia across western North America. In order to allow us to generate a larger mitochondrial data set, we used 454 seqeuncing to reconstruct the complete mitochondrial genome in the early stages of the project. Our analysis reveals what appears to be a complex history of isolation and multiple invasions among some lineages. The study provides evidence of multiple glacial refugia and suggests that historical climactic isolations have been important mechanisms in determining genetic structure of insects in western North America. Our ability to generate a large mitochondrial data set through mitochondrial genome reconstruction greatly improved nodal support of our mitochondrial gene tree, and allowed us to make stronger inference of relationships between lineages and timing of divergence events.

Application of Genome Reduction, Next Generation Sequencing, and KASPar Genotyping in Development, Characterization, and Linkage Mapping of Single Nucleotide Polymorphisms in the Grain Amaranths and Quinoa

Smith, Scott Matthew 13 March 2013 (has links) (PDF)
The grain amaranths (Amaranthus sp.) and quinoa (Chenopodium quinoa Willd.) are important seed crops in South America. These crops have gained international attention in recent years for their nutritional quality and tolerance to abiotic stress. We report the identification and development of functional single nucleotide polymorphism (SNP) assays for both amaranth and quinoa. SNPs were identified using a genome reduction protocol and next generation sequencing. SNP assays are based on KASPar genotyping chemistry and were detected using the Fluidigm dynamic array platform. A diversity screen consisting of 41 amaranth accessions showed that the minor allele frequency (MAF) of the amaranth markers ranged from 0.05 to 0.5 with an average MAF of 0.27. A diversity screen of 113 quinoa accessions showed that the MAF of the quinoa markers ranged from 0.02 to 0.5 with an average MAF of 0.28. Linkage mapping in amaranth produced a linkage map consisting of 16 linkage groups, presumably corresponding to each of the 16 amaranth haploid chromosomes. This map spans 1288 cM with an average marker density of 3.1 cM per marker. Linkage mapping in quinoa resulted in a linkage map consisting of 29 linkage groups with 20 large linkage groups, spanning 1,404 cM with a marker density of 3.1 cM per SNP marker. The SNPs identified here represent important genomic tools needed for genetic dissection of agronomically important characteristics and advanced genetic analysis of agronomic traits in amaranth and quinoa. We also describe in detail the scalable and cost effective SNP genotyping method used in this research. This method is based on KBioscience's competitive allele specific PCR amplification of target sequences and endpoint fluorescence genotyping (KASPar) using a FRET capable plate reader or Fluidigm's dynamic array high throughput platform.

Undergraduate Students' Conceptions of NGSS Science and Engineering Practices

Webb, Jessie 22 August 2023 (has links) (PDF)
In 2013, a new set of science standards was introduced for K-12 science education, called the Next Generation Science Standards (NGSS), which focused on three dimensions of science learning that work together: disciplinary core ideas, crosscutting concepts, and science and engineering practices. These standards are novel in their emphasis on students needing more than only content knowledge to learn science and engineering. The NGSS science and engineering practices (SEPs) stress the importance of students engaging in the authentic practices of scientists and engineers to help them think like a scientist, practice science themselves, and overcome the misconception that science is a collection of isolated facts (NRC, 2012a). These SEPs include: asking questions and defining problems, developing and using models, planning and carrying out investigations, analyzing and interpreting data, using mathematics and computational thinking, constructing explanations and designing solutions, engaging in argument from evidence, and obtaining, evaluating, and communicating information. We performed a qualitative study to determine the conceptions of undergraduate students, the majority of whom were enrolled in STEM majors, about the SEPs. With a theoretical framework of phenomenography guiding our study's design, we conducted deep, open-ended interviews with 59 undergraduate students. The analysis consisted of transcribing interviews, coding transcriptions, writing descriptions of the codes to identify a limited number of distinct categories that describe how students viewed individual SEPs, and analyzing relationships among these categories to create outcome spaces for the ways students viewed the SEPs. In the current dissertation, we present the students' specific conceptions of each of the SEPs. Although the students had a better understanding of some of the SEPs than others (e.g., they understood planning and carrying out investigations and using mathematics and computational thinking best), we found that undergraduates did not have a high level of understanding of any SEP. This is similar to conceptions of undergraduates in the literature, which mostly consisted of preservice teachers. The undergraduates in this study conflated many of the SEPs, misinterpreted SEPs based on the everyday meaning of terms in the practices (i.e., they discussed an everyday meaning of words like "questions" instead of focusing on the unique meaning of "questions" in a scientific context), and perceived that the structured learning activities in which they engage in their current coursework limit their abilities to engage in the SEPs. These results suggest that STEM students need more opportunities to authentically engage in the SEPs in open-ended environments, coupled with explicit instruction that emphasizes the difference between everyday usages of words in the SEPs and their scientific meanings.

Protocol and System Design for a Service-centric Network Architecture

Huang, Xin 01 February 2010 (has links)
Next-generation Internet will be governed by the need for flexibility. Heterogeneous end-systems, novel applications, and security and manageability challenges require networks to provide a broad range of services that go beyond store-and-forward. Following this trend, a service-centric network architecture is proposed for the next-generation Internet. It utilizes router-based programmability to provide packet processing services inside the network and decompose communications into these service blocks. By providing different compositions of services along the data path, such network can customize its connections to satisfy various communication requirements. This design extends the flexibility of the Internet to meet its next-generation challenges. This work addresses three major challenges in implementing such service-centric networks. Finding the optimal path for a given composition of services is the first challenge. This is called "service routing" since both service availability and routing cost need to be considered. Novel algorithms and a matching protocol are designed to solve the service routing problem in large scale networks. A prototype based on Emulab is implemented to demonstrate and evaluate our design. Finding the optimal composition of services to satisfy the communication requirements of a given connection is the second challenge. This is called "service composition." A novel decision making framework is proposed, which allows the deduction of the service composition problem into a planning problem and automates the composition of service according to specified communication requirements. A further investigation shows that extending this decision making framework to combine the service routing and service composition problems yields a better solution than solving them separately. Run-time resource management on the data plane is the third challenge. Several run-time task mapping approaches have been proposed for Network Processor systems. An evaluation methodology based on queuing network is designed to systematically evaluate and compare these solutions under various network traffic scenarios. The results of this work give qualitative and quantitative insights into next-generation Internet design that combines issues from computer networking, architecture, and system design.

Kvinnor och deras närståendes upplevelser av postpartumpsykos : en litteraturöversikt / Women and their next of kin's experience of postpartum psychosis : a litterature review

Lingegård, Agnes, Karlsson, Linda January 2022 (has links)
Postpartumpsykos är ett akut psykiatriskt tillstånd som drabbar ungefär 0,1-0,2 procent av alla nyförlösta kvinnor. Postpartumpsykos uppstår vanligen mellan dag tre och dag tio efter förlossningen och symtom kan innefatta ångest, irritabilitet, sömnsvårigheter, vanföreställningar och hallucinationer. Tillståndet är allvarligt och kräver inneliggande vård och behandling. När en kvinna drabbas av postnatal psykisk ohälsa är det sedan tidigare känt att även närstående till henne påverkas negativt. Syftet med denna litteraturöversikt är att beskriva kvinnor och deras närståendes upplevelser av postpartumpsykos. En icke-systematisk litteraturöversikt användes som metod för att besvara arbetets syfte. Studier med kvalitativ ansats inkluderades i litteraturöversiktens resultatsammanställning. Totalt inkluderades 13 artiklar där det efter sammanställning identifierades tre huvudteman med tre underteman vardera. Huvudteman som identifierades följde sjukdomsförloppets utveckling över tid: insjuknandet och sjukdomen, behandling och vårdtiden, återhämtning och tiden efter sjukdomen. Resultatet visade att insjuknandet till en början upplevdes som något diffust där närstående hade svårt att förstå att något var allvarligt fel. Sedan utvecklade kvinnorna allvarliga psykotiska symtom vilka präglades av paranoia och vanföreställningar om sin omvärld. Känslor och tankar av skuldbeläggande karaktär uppstod hos både kvinnorna och de närstående där de upplevde ett behov av att leta efter svar på varför de drabbats av sjukdomen. Behandlingen och vårdtiden upplevdes som en prövande tid för både kvinnorna och deras närstående. Kvinnorna var ofta separerade från sina barn och självständigt ansvar hamnade på de närstående avseende. omhändertagande av barn och hem. Ett stort behov av stöd identifierades där upplevelsen av detta varierade beroende på vilken behandling kvinnan erhöll. Att hela familjen inkluderades i behandlingen var viktigt för att ha en god upplevelse av vårdtiden. När kvinnorna skrevs ut från heldygnsvård och återvände till hemmet upplevdes det som en utmanande tid och behovet av fortsatt stöd var stort för att främja återhämtningen. De psykotiska symtomen minskade under denna tid men kunde i stället övergå i depressiva symtom. Social interaktion var en viktig del under återhämtningen och upplevelsen av hur relationerna kvinnorna och de närstående emellan hade förändrats var i stort fokus under denna period. Slutsatsen av studien visade upplevelsen av de utmaningar kvinnor med postpartum psykos och hennes närstående ställdes inför i samband med pykosen. Skam- och skuldkänslor upplevdes av både kvinnorna och deras närstående. Behovet av förbättringar gällande kunskap om tillståndet både i allmänhet och inom hälso- och sjukvården identifierades. Delaktighet och information inom vård och behandling önskades av deltagarna. Vikten av stöd under vårdtiden och återhämtningen var betydelsefull för kvinnan och hennes närstående. / Postpartum psychosis is a serious condition that affects approximately 0,1-0,2 % of all women postpartum. The women who develop the condition need inpatient care and often experience symptoms such as anxiety, irritability, lack of sleep, delusions, and hallucinations. When women develop postnatal mental illness it is previously known that their next of kin also suffer during this time. This study aimes to describe women and their next of kins' experience of postpartum psychosis. A non-systematic literature review was chosen as method for this study. The articles that the authors included were of a qualitative approach. A total of thirteen articles were included in the result and three main themes were identified within the data; becoming ill, treatment and hospital stay and recovery and aftermath. Findings of the results shows that becoming ill is often experienced as something diffuse which led to that neither the women or her next of kin could tell that something serious was going on. The women later developed psychotic symptoms such as paranoia and delusions. The feeling of guilt was identified as a powerful emotion. The time spent at the hospital was identified as a difficult time for both the women who often felt isolated and not being able to see their children, but also for her next of kin who now was taking care of the newborn baby. Information and participation in the treatment were identified as important for both the women and her next of kin during the hospital stay. Support needs were identified in both groups. The recovery was experienced as a tough time for the women and social interaction was found to be an important part of the recovery. During the aftermath, many participants experienced a change in their relationships. The conclusion of this study illustrates the challenging experience of postpartum psychosis. Feelings of shame and guilt were experienced by both the women and next of kin. Improvements are needed in awareness of this condition and a lack of qualification is experienced in the healthcare system. Support needs and including family during the hospital care is desirable for both the women and her next of kin'.
